Army Readies for Matchup Against Air Force
October 30, 2017 | Men's Rugby
COLORADO SPRINGS, Colo. - The No. 9-ranked Army West Point men's rugby team will travel to Colorado to face No.15th-ranked Air Force in its final match of the fall season on Friday at the U.S. Air Force Academy, with kickoff scheduled for 5:30 p.m. ET.

- The Black Knights are looking to improve to 3-1 overall in their series against Air Force.
- In last year's meeting, Army boasted a 62-19 victory at the Anderson Rugby Complex over the Falcons.
- Senior Jake Lachina accounted for 15 points scored against Air Force, with three tries.
- Senior Jon Kim currently leads the team with 73 points on 27 conversions, two tries, and three penalty kicks.
- The Falcons are entering the match coming off a two-game losing streak in conference play.
- They dropped a 41-49 decision last weekend against Colorado University.
- Junior flyhalf Eric Menser returns as a starter for Air Force.
- Menser recently posted five points in the team's game against Colorado.
